Frequently Asked Questions about Winigan

What type of rentals are currently available in Winigan?

There are currently 35 Apartments for Rent in Winigan, MO with pricing that ranges from $375 to $1,387. There are also 32 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Winigan ranging from $875 to $5,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Winigan?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Winigan ranges from $875 to $5,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,598.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Winigan?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Winigan range from $560 to $1,375,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$925 to $1,850.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,100 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$900.
